Gong (CSound instrument) | ||
This instruments uses the technique to shape an envelope.
sr = 44100 kr = 441 ksmps= 100 nchnls = 1 instr 1; ***************************************************************** ilen = p3 ifrq = cpspch(p4) print ifrq ifrq1 = 1.0000 * ifrq ifrq2 = 1.1541 * ifrq ifrq3 = 1.6041 * ifrq ifrq4 = 1.5208 * ifrq ifrq5 = 1.4166 * ifrq ifrq6 = 2.7916 * ifrq ifrq7 = 3.3833 * ifrq iamp = p5 iamp1 = 1.0000 * iamp iamp2 = 0.8333 * iamp iamp3 = 0.6667 * iamp iamp4 = 1.0000 * iamp iamp5 = 0.3333 * iamp iamp6 = 0.3333 * iamp iamp7 = 0.3333 * iamp aenv1 oscili iamp1, 1/ilen, 2 aenv2 oscili iamp2, 1/ilen, 2 aenv3 oscili iamp3, 1/ilen, 2 aenv4 oscili iamp4, 1/ilen, 2 aenv5 oscili iamp5, 1/ilen, 2 aenv6 oscili iamp6, 1/ilen, 2 aenv7 oscili iamp7, 1/ilen, 2 asig1 oscili aenv1, ifrq1, 1 asig2 oscili aenv2, ifrq2, 1 asig3 oscili aenv3, ifrq3, 1 asig4 oscili aenv4, ifrq4, 1 asig5 oscili aenv5, ifrq5, 1 asig6 oscili aenv6, ifrq6, 1 asig7 oscili aenv7, ifrq7, 1 out asig1 + asig2 + asig3 + asig4 + asig5 + asig6 + asig7 endin f1 0 512 9 1 1 0 ; basic waveform f2 0 513 5 128 512 1 ; envelopes i1 0 6 7.09 5000 i1 6 6 7.09 5000 i1 12 6 7.09 5000
